Job Description:

  • Overseeing the registration of new products in alignment with the launch plan to ensure the timely introduction of products to the market.
  • Managing product license renewals, company licenses, GMP clearances, amendments, and annual reports to maintain regulatory compliance.
  • Ensuring that all registration licenses remain up to date throughout the product lifecycle, adhering to local regulatory requirements.
  • Effectively managing regulatory activities related to changes and quality issues to maintain compliance and ensure smooth operations.
  • Providing strategic regulatory guidance to ensure alignment with all relevant regulations and standards.
  • Building and maintaining strong professional relationships with local health authorities and regulatory agencies as required.
  • Taking responsibility for routine regulatory tasks associated with the assigned product portfolio.
  • Coordinating activities related to Bioavailability (BA) and Bioequivalence (BE) studies, clinical study centres, and regulatory authorities.
  • Acting as the Pharmacovigilance coordinator to enhance public health and safety concerning the use of pharmaceutical products.
